Like the forum post by Dragoneer said, it's not because they want to stop adult cub art, but because sites they use to maintain their donations to keep the site going keep dropping them or not accepting them specificly due to this controversial subject.
Also, like 'neer said, Inkbunny and similar sites use the same payment transfer websites that booted FA, so it's likely that they'll also get dropped in the near future as well.
Basicly, this means that anywhere you go is going to be a set-up for a let-down.
Your only real option would be to make your own personal website to upload artwork, upload censored pictures here with links to the uncensored images in the description.
It might skirt the policies enough to be fair.
